Background thread based socket server for vim

import sys | |
import socket | |
import select | |
import Queue | |
import threading | |
import time | |
import vim | |
import os | |
class LogError(Exception): | |
pass | |
class Logger: | |
""" Abstract class for all logger implementations. | |
Concrete classes will log messages using various methods, | |
e.g. write to a file. | |
""" | |
(ERROR,INFO,DEBUG) = (0,1,2) | |
TYPES = ("ERROR","Info","Debug") | |
debug_level = ERROR | |
def __init__(self,debug_level): | |
pass | |
def log(self, string, level): | |
""" Log a message """ | |
pass | |
def shutdown(self): | |
""" Action to perform when closing the logger """ | |
pass | |
def time(self): | |
""" Get a nicely formatted time string """ | |
return time.strftime("%a %d %Y %H:%M:%S", \\ | |
time.localtime()) | |
def format(self,string,level): | |
display_level = self.TYPES[level] | |
""" Format the error message in a standard way """ | |
return "- [%s] {%s} %s" %(display_level, self.time(), str(string)) | |
class FileLogger(Logger): | |
""" Log messages to a window. | |
The window object is passed in on construction, but | |
only created if a message is written. | |
""" | |
def __init__(self,debug_level,filename): | |
self.filename = os.path.expanduser(filename) | |
self.f = None | |
self.debug_level = int(debug_level) | |
def __open(self): | |
try: | |
self.f = open(self.filename,'w') | |
except IOError as e: | |
raise LogError("Invalid file name '%s' for log file: %s" \\ | |
%(self.filename,str(e))) | |
except: | |
raise LogError("Error using file '%s' as a log file: %s" \\ | |
%(self.filename,sys.exc_info()[0])) | |
def shutdown(self): | |
if self.f is not None: | |
self.f.close() | |
def log(self, string, level): | |
if level > self.debug_level: | |
return | |
if self.f is None: | |
self.__open() | |
self.f.write(\\ | |
self.format(string,level)+"\\n") | |
self.f.flush() | |
class QueueServer(threading.Thread): | |
def __init__(self, host, port, message_queue, lock): | |
self.__message_queue = message_queue | |
self.__host = host | |
self.__port = port | |
self.__logger = FileLogger(Logger.DEBUG, "queueserver.log") | |
self.__lock = lock | |
threading.Thread.__init__(self) | |
def log(self, message): | |
self.__logger.log(message, Logger.DEBUG) | |
def run(self): | |
try: | |
self.log("Started") | |
self.log("Listening on port %s" % self.__port) | |
s = socket.socket(socket.AF_INET, socket.SOCK_STREAM) | |
s.setblocking(0) | |
s.bind((self.__host, self.__port)) | |
s.listen(5) | |
while 1: | |
try: | |
self.peek_for_exit() | |
client, address = s.accept() | |
self.log("Found client, %s" % str(address)) | |
self.client_read(client) | |
while 1: | |
self.log("Waiting for message") | |
message = self.__message_queue.get() | |
self.log("Received message: %s" % message) | |
self.check_exit(message) | |
self.client_write(client, message) | |
if not self.client_read(client): | |
self.log("Closing client connection") | |
client.close() | |
break | |
except socket.error, e: | |
if e.errno == 11: | |
pass | |
else: | |
if client: | |
client.close() | |
raise e | |
except Exception, e: | |
self.log("Error: %s" % str(sys.exc_info())) | |
self.log("Stopping server") | |
raise e | |
def client_write(self, client, msg): | |
self.log("Writing message: %s" % msg) | |
client.send(msg) | |
def client_read(self, client): | |
self.log("Receiving") | |
data = client.recv(1024) | |
if data == "": | |
self.log("Client connection closed") | |
return False | |
else: | |
self.log("Received data: %s" % data) | |
self.__lock.acquire() | |
self.log("Acquired lock") | |
vim.current.buffer.append(data.strip().split("\\n")) | |
self.__lock.release() | |
self.log("Written to buffer") | |
return True | |
def peek_for_exit(self): | |
try: | |
self.check_exit(self.__message_queue.get_nowait()) | |
except Queue.Empty: | |
pass | |
def check_exit(self, message): | |
if message == "exit": | |
raise Exception("Exiting") | |
class BackgroundSocketServer: | |
def __init__(self): | |
self.__message_queue = Queue.Queue(0) | |
self.__lock = threading.Lock() | |
self.__thread = None | |
def __del__(self): | |
self.stop() | |
def start(self): | |
if self.__thread: | |
print self.__thread.is_alive() | |
if self.__thread and self.__thread.is_alive(): | |
print "Already running!" | |
else: | |
self.__thread = QueueServer('127.0.0.1', 9000, self.__message_queue, | |
self.__lock) | |
self.__thread.start() | |
print "Started queue server thread" | |
def send_message(self, message): | |
self.__message_queue.put(message) | |
def stop(self): | |
if self.__thread and self.__thread.is_alive(): | |
print "Sending exit message" | |
self.__message_queue.put_nowait("exit") | |
print "Joining threads" | |
self.__thread.join() | |
print "Stopped" | |
else: | |
print "Already stopped!" |
